Easy to Store
One of the best things you can do to preserve your wooden furniture is to learn how to store it properly. Wooden furniture is designed to be placed on the ground, so you should place it on a pallet or tarp to protect it from spills or moisture. It is also important to check the metal attached to your wooden furniture for rust to prevent stains.
If you have wooden furniture that will be stored in a basement or attic, you should consider purchasing a dehumidifier. This will help to control the humidity in the room, which will preserve your wooden furniture for a long time. While purchasing wooden furniture, consider the materials used to make it. The prices of wooden furniture vary based on the wood type and thickness. If the wood is solid, the material will be heavier and more expensive than if it were veneered. In addition, the features of wooden furniture may also determine the purchase cost.
